About The Position

Under the direct supervision of the Unit Charge Nurse, the Behavioral Technician helps maintain a safe, supportive, and therapeutic environment for individuals in mental health crisis. This role requires emotional sensitivity, adaptability, and proactive behavioral observation. Working closely with a multidisciplinary team, the technician monitors individuals, assists with daily activities, and responds compassionately to behavioral changes. The ideal candidate is empathetic, person-centered, and thrives in dynamic settings. This is a 24/7 facility with shifts available across all hours. Compensation is based on experience.

Responsibilities

  • Assist Nursing staff with duties as directed, for example: patient supervision, vitals, room searches, patient searches, etc.
  • Recognizes, responds to, and assists in crisis situations and provides interventions as necessary.
  • Delivers indirect and selected direct patient care as directed by facility leadership.
  • Conducts intake processes, searches of belongings and patients and completes BAC’s and drug screen observations as directed by facility leadership.
  • Monitors patient activity and documents any significant patient issues.
  • Records rounds and ensures patient safety as specified in EHR.
  • Conducts regular facility and grounds checks, advising facility leadership of any irregularities or safety concerns.
  • Notifies and reports any health and safety issues, significant patient concerns and any out of the ordinary occurrences to facility leadership immediately.
  • Completes all documentation requirements prior to the end of the shift.
  • Performs basic housekeeping duties.
  • Facilitates and leads daily groups as directed by facility leadership if applicable.
  • Attends all staff meetings and in-service trainings.
  • Completes all online training, policy verification, and ensures that their employee HR file is kept up to date.
